Turki Khagha

Turki Khagha is a village located in Dhamdaha subdivision of Purnia district in Bihar,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Dhamdaha (tehsildar office) and 30km away from district headquarter Purnia. As per 2009 stats, Damdaha East is the gram panchayat of Turki Khagha village.

About Turki Khagha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Turki Khagha is 223330. The village spans a total geographical area of 249 hectares. Purnia is nearest town to Turki Khagha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.

Population of Turki Khagha

Below is a concise population overview of Turki Khagha as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 418 225 193
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 62 35 27
Scheduled Castes (SC) 19 10 9
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 239 137 102
Illiterate Population 179 88 91

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Turki Khagha village:

  • The total population of Turki Khagha village is around 418, including approximately 225 males and 193 females, with a sex ratio of 857 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 62 children aged 0–6 years in Turki Khagha village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Turki Khagha village has 19 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Turki Khagha village is about 57.18%, with male literacy at 60.89% and female literacy at 52.85%.
  • There are around 83 households in Turki Khagha village.

Connectivity of Turki Khagha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Turki Khagha. As per the 2011 stats, Turki Khagha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
